Instructions
  1. In the bottom of a 3.5-4 quart Crock Pot, place the 2 teaspoons of lemon juice.
  2. Add the blueberries and white sugar.
  3. Stir the contents. Cover the Crock Pot. Cook either on LOW for 4-5 hours or on HIGH for 2-2 ½ hours. Until boiling.
  4. When the fruit is boiling, prepare the Grunt Dumpling Dough. In a large bowl and a wire whisk, combine the flour, baking powder, salt, and ground cinnamon.
  5. Add the unsalted butter, and cut in with a pastry blender until the mixture resembles crumbs.
  6. Add the milk, and stir with a fork until the mixture is combined. Do not over mix.
  7. Drop by spoonfuls onto the top of the hot fruit in the Crock Pot.
  8. Cover the Crock Pot tightly with the lid and continue to cook on HIGH for 30 minutes or until toothpick inserted in the middle comes out clean.
